Lainey Wilson's Journey: A 14-Year Overnight Success

If you think Lainey Wilson appeared out of nowhere, think again. The artist herself has been quick to set the record straight. Lainey describes herself as "a 14-year overnight success" — a phrase that perfectly captures both the grind and the glory of her story.

Her connection to music started early. Lainey recalls feeling completely at home on a stage at just age 5, a pull toward performance that never faded. As a teenager, she was so hungry to perform that she once sang on top of an air conditioning unit in exchange for free hotdogs — a detail that says everything about her scrappy, never-quit spirit.

After years of paying dues in Nashville, grinding through the industry's notoriously tough early stages, Lainey finally signed a major label record deal in 2019. It was the beginning of the chapter the world would come to know — but the foundation had been built long before.

The Breakthrough: ACM Awards and 'Things a Man Oughta Know'

If there was a single moment that announced Lainey Wilson to mainstream America, it was the 2022 ACM Awards, where she took home three trophies in a single night. The crown jewel was Song of the Year for her breakout hit "Things a Man Oughta Know" — a track that resonated with millions and dominated country radio.

The song's themes of self-worth, authenticity, and hard-won wisdom felt tailor-made for Wilson's voice and her story. It wasn't just a hit; it was a statement. From that moment, her ascent was unstoppable. She has since claimed the titles of CMA Entertainer of the Year and ACM Entertainer of the Year, cementing her status as the genre's defining artist of her era.

Her fourth studio album, Bell Bottom Country, further cemented her identity — a record that leans hard into the retro-inspired, deeply personal sound she has made her own.

Lainey and Duck: Love, Engagement, and Starting a Family

Lainey's personal life has been just as headline-grabbing as her professional one. Her relationship with Devlin "Duck" Hodges — a former NFL quarterback who played for the Pittsburgh Steelers — has been a favorite topic for fans. The couple, whose personalities and passions seem to complement each other perfectly, got engaged and have been open about their desire to build a life together beyond the spotlight.

The decision to freeze her eggs, revealed so publicly in the Netflix documentary trailer, is a bold and vulnerable move. Lainey has opened up about her plans to freeze her eggs, framing it as a practical step for someone whose career demands constant touring and performance. It's a deeply relatable decision for many women in demanding careers, and her willingness to share it openly has resonated widely.
